I'm currently working with Altium Designer 10. I have a 6 layer PCB. On the 2 power planes I would like to place some copper text. I can place the text within a polygon pour cutout and its visible on the pcb editor. But when I switch to the 3D view I see that the polygon pour cutout is there but the copper text is not.
Is there a way to place copper text onto a power plane? Or is it a case of having to change the power plane to a signal layer to achieve this.
